Compare all specifications:
1962 Chevrolet Corvette | 2008 Kia Carens | |
Make | Chevrolet | Kia |
Model | Corvette | Carens |
Year Released | 1962 | 2008 |
Body Type | Convertible | Minivan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5354 cc | 1990 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 251 HP | 0 HP |
Torque | 475 Nm | 250 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 17.7: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Top Speed | 241 km/hour | 170 km/hour |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1315 kg | 1511 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4500 mm | 4500 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1280 mm | 1620 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2600 mm | 2570 mm |
